The question

How can an investment fund that guarantees a monthly profit of around 4%, with the bank buying goods on behalf of the client and guaranteeing their purchase from him, be compliant with Islamic Sharia?

Share this answer

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 20261 min readAlso available in العربية
The answer

Guaranteeing profit in transactions renders them impermissible, moving them from permissibility to prohibition. For example, stipulating a guarantee in a contract invalidates it and turns it into a loan. Therefore, it is not permissible to participate in investment funds that stipulate a profit guarantee.
